Output 0d25dd883ea559e56a5c0c808867422126159eb61de7161d4954580c6dad0d54:17

value
20304524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a0e9663362e77c098d16ab336d7703edeaa9d8b OP_EQUAL
address
35XPn9v4N21ATwmRKQ7TxbKvmi7cQJrQtL
transaction
0d25dd883ea559e56a5c0c808867422126159eb61de7161d4954580c6dad0d54
spent
true